WEST TEXAS USES STRONG SECOND HALF
TO DEFEAT ZIAS AT GREYHOUND ARENA
Lady Buffaloes Improve to 14-2 Overall

PORTALES, NM — The Lady Buffaloes of West Texas A&M University, ranked #13 in NCAA Division II, led Eastern New Mexico University by just two points, at halftime, but pulled away for a 65-46 victory in Lone Star Conference action, Jan. 15 at Greyhound Arena.

WTAMU, which held a 25-23 lead at the intermission, improved to 14-2 overall and 6-1 in the LSC South. ENMU dropped to 7-6 and 1-3 in the LSC South.

West Texas opened the second half with a 10-2 run, as the Lady Buffs took a 35-25 advantage. WTAMU led 43-31 with 9:39 left, and held a 54-39 margin with 4:18 remaining.

The Lady Buffs shot 57.9% in the second half (11 of 19), while limiting the Zias to just 23.1% (6-26) over the final 20 minutes. For the game, West Texas shot 43.2% (19 of 44) and ENMU shot 29.8% (17 of 57). WTAMU earned a 42-39 rebounding margin, as Latraica Spencer led all players with 10 caroms. Brandi Green and Andrian Quihuis added 7 rebounds each.

ENMU led 13-7 early in the game, and held the lead for most of the first half. West Texas achieved its two-point halftime margin on a basket by Quihuis with just 4 seconds left. The top scorer for Eastern was Brandi Bates (Jr., G/F, Jr. Plainview, TX/Plainview H.S.) with 8 points. Katheryne Hickman (Jr., P/F, San Antonio, TX/Castle Hills Baptist) and Amanda Hewitt (Sr., P, San Antonio, TX/Madison H.S.) each provided the Zias with 6 points.

Overall, 8 ENMU players contributed at least 4 points. Hickman and Hewitt grabbed 6 rebounds apiece to lead the Zias on the boards. Bates had 5 rebounds, and also recorded 2 assists and 3 steals.

Eastern New Mexico plays its next two games on the road. The Zias will be at Texas Woman’s University in Denton, Texas on Mon., Jan. 17 for a 6:00 p.m. (MST) tipoff. ENMU will play at Texas A&M-Commerce on Tues., Jan. 18 at 6:00 p.m. (MST).
